Retiring GOCC president receives award

Retiring Glen Oaks Community College President David Devier received special recognition over the weekend from a distinguished organization.

Devier was honored by Phi Theta Kappa Honor Society with the Michael Bennett Lifetime Achievement Award. It was presented Saturday in Orlando.

According to the honor society, the award is given to retiring college presidents who have shown support of student-success initiatives leading to stronger pathways to completion, transfer and employment.

Recipients of the award are student-nominated.

Devier is one of nine retiring college presidents and chancellors to receive the award.
